The best Side of software development





Alternatively, it is possible to post your project and our crew will pick out and send you the most effective matching corporations in about one hour. It’s free and there is no obligation to rent.

CareerOneStop consists of a huge selection of occupational profiles with data available by point out and metro space. You will discover inbound links while in the left-hand aspect menu to compare occupational work by point out and occupational wages by community spot or metro location. There is certainly also a salary details Device to search for wages by zip code.

If a coefficient is a range multiplied by a variable, why is definitely the "correlation coefficient" called as a result?

Ongoing integration and continual delivery (CI/CD): CI/CD streamlines the process of setting up, testing and deploying software. CI entails quickly integrating code modifications from a number of developers into a shared repository, ensuring that the code base is constantly examined for difficulties and conflicts.

g., one which connects to a tool, one which ship data files out to that unit, tells it to execute an software in its Flash memory and so forth. In lieu of hand-coding a CoraScript, I would like to produce a C# library that'll create this kind of script. Would this C# library be called a wrapper library for CoraScript scripting language?

Security and Lawful Compliance: Stability will not be a just one-time process, and reducing corners here can be extremely high-priced later on (when it comes to data breaches or lawful repercussions). Based upon your app, you could will need periodic safety audits or updates to address newly discovered vulnerabilities. For example, you could possibly funds for an annual penetration exam by an external security organization (which could possibly be a few thousand bucks) if your app deals with sensitive details. You’ll also need to have to maintain up with privacy restrictions. Regulations like GDPR (in Europe) and CCPA (in California) have precise demands about person information managing, and non-compliance can lead to fines.

The type of app and also the market it operates in can introduce certain Expense factors. As an illustration, a gaming app may possibly call for comprehensive 3D graphics or possibly a custom made physics engine, pushing expenses up with specialized development and structure do the job.

Software builders produce the computer apps that allow consumers to try and do unique tasks as well as the underlying programs that operate the devices or Manage networks. Software good quality assurance analysts and testers structure and execute software tests to determine troubles and find out how the software will work.

By way of example, incorporating advanced technologies like artificial intelligence or device Studying can considerably improve the scope – industry info confirms that features like AI/ML, IoT integration, or sophisticated real-time functionality are major cost motorists.

Learning software development is surely an ongoing approach. Even seasoned developers carry on to check out new more info systems and strategies.

This is when the constructing transpires! Builders use their programming knowledge to convey the design to lifestyle, producing the code that embodies the application’s logic and performance.

Discover the world of software development With this extensive guide for newbies. Uncover what software development is and why it issues, delve into critical ideas, uncover the crucial ways while in the development procedure, and find out how software styles industries and technologies.

Agile methodologies are well-fitted to jobs exactly where demands could possibly shift or evolve, and where delivering Functioning software promptly is usually a priority.

We feel that software, Particularly instructional tools, need to always be open and absolutely free. We depend on our Local community to aid and assist us to repeatedly improve our LMS. Help our builders by making a donation.

Leave a Reply

Your email address will not be published. Required fields are marked *